ARRIVAL IN HANOI

Hanoi is the capital of the Socialist Republic of Vietnam and the country’s second largest city by population. This thousand-year-old city is considered one of the main cultural centres of Vietnam, where most Vietnamese dynasties have left their imprint. Even though some relics have not survived through wars and time, the city still has many interesting cultural and historic monuments for visitors and residents alike.. The city hosts more cultural sites than any other city in Vietnam.

BAC HA - SAPA

After your breakfast at the homestay. Bid farewell to the host and make your way to the hill-tribe market (Sunday: Bac Ha market; Tuesday: Coc Ly market; Saturday: Can Cau market). Here you will see some ethnic minority groups such as Flower Hmong, Phu La, Yao, Tay, Nung…etc. They are from different valleys, gather around for the trading. It is an awesome experience of seeing colors, understanding traditions and feeling the atmosphere. The market offers a variety of local products includes colorful embroidery, handicrafts and all types of daily necessary stuffs. Here also available animal market where people sell and buy or barter animal such as dogs, pot-bellied pigs, cows, buffalos and so on. Lunch is served at a local restaurant.

HOI AN FREE DAY

Hội An is a city on Vietnam’s central coast known for its well-preserved Ancient Town, cut through with canals. The former port city’s melting-pot history is reflected in its architecture, a mix of eras and styles from wooden Chinese shop houses and temples to colorful French colonial buildings. This is also known as the silk paradise with a lot of tailor-made shops for cloths and shoes. The town is about 7 km from Cua Dai Beach.

CU CHI TUNNELS AND CAO DAI TEMPLE

This morning, the car will take you out of the bustling city for Cu Chi District, locates approximately 70 km northwest of Saigon. This is a beautiful green land with fruit gardens, rice paddies and plantations. Cu Chi Tunnels are like a spider web in the soil of Cu Chi District. It consists of more than 200km of narrow underground tunnels that connecting half or total covered hideouts, shelters, fighting bunkers, hospital, school, living rooms and so on… All was built and used by Viet Cong for resistance against their enemy during the French and American war. After touring Cu Chi we make our way for approximately 1hr to Tay Ninh, to the Cao Dai Temple. Here you will watch part of a Cao Dai service, with an explanation of this very different religion. MEKONG DELTA - SAIGON

The watery world of the Mekong Delta is home to many bustling floating markets. This day, we take a boat trip and exploring the vibrant floating market of Cai Rang, where the trading way is unique; each boat usually sells one particular item, whether it be pumpkins, pineapples, sugar canes.
